| Mary-Jane studied at Wits University
where she obtained her honours degree in Geography and Environmental
Studies (1985). She has seventeen years experience in the environmental
field, covering research, consulting and industry. As a result, Mary-Jane
has been involved in various aspects of environmental management,
including Environmental Impact Assessment, Environmental Management
Plans, rehabilitation plans, development of environmental policies
and guidelines, Environmental Management Systems, and environmental
auditing. She has undertaken several presentations and has published
papers on these subjects.
One of the most interesting and exciting projects in which Mary-Jane
has been involved was that of managing and co-ordinating the environmental
aspects of the Cape Town 2004 Olympic Bid. Mary-Jane's particular
interest is that of integrating environmental management into business
strategy, business planning and financial accounting and reporting
systems. Due to this interest, she has become increasingly involved
in Corporate Environmental Reporting, Environmental Management Systems
and Environmental Auditing. Mary-Jane has successfully completed
an internationally certified EARA (Environmental Auditor's Registration
Association) Environmental Auditing course.
